数据可视化pyecharts
可视化设计过程:
采用jupyter notebook进行代码编写,因为ipynb文件方便传输到教师的电脑中检查,可以直接pip install jupyter notebook之后将文件上传到notebook网页中,然后一个框一个框的依次运行,就可以当场返回结果。根据需求设计来做。
采用了pyecharts进行数据可视化,pyecharts可以直接返回html文件,在有需要时方便进行前端页面编写等操作。
负责爬取数据的同学对于爬取下来的数据格式和文件名定义给出了如下图所示的标准:
之后进入数据可视化流程。首先以普通表格式返回一个输出结果确认可以从文件中读取到数据
然后,可视化系统分析了新冠病毒的整体情况,我们汇总得到全球各个国家的累计确诊人数和全国各个省份的累计确诊人数,然后使用pyecharts绘制确诊人数热力图,颜色越深对应的确诊人数越高
对应部分主要代码如下:
展示出来的热力图效果则如下所示: